iTunes text message scam

Malicious individuals are reportedly sending scam text messages claiming to be from Apple’s music service iTunes to a large number of people. The message is believed to claim the recipient’s iTunes account has been frozen and asks them to click on a link to ‘validate their [iTunes] account’.

SCAM: Fake AFP traffic infringement notices

The Australian Federal Police (AFP) has warned of scam ‘traffic infringement notices’ being delivered to people by email.

Support for Internet Explorer ends

January 13 is the last day for business and individual users to move off older versions of the Internet Explorer web browser, before Microsoft pulls the plug on support including security patches.
